"The Wizard of Oz" is a story that spans decades, written one hundred and twenty years ago. The students in Presbyterian School's 7th grade drama class are bringing it back again in Radio Theater Form! Radio Theater once united the nation during World War Two when families gathered around their radios to listen to important announcements and were transported from the comfort of their living rooms to new worlds where their beloved stories came to life. This Wizard of Oz broadcast uses the original radio theater transcript broadcasted Christmas Day in 1950. Presbyterian School students have worked hard learning new technology and recording their lines and songs. They've utilized iMovie and Garageband producing character voices, sound effects, and musical techniques.
